Old, limited, test equipment can be valuable if you know the limits and take what you see with a grain of salt.
In one case I were equipped with insufficcient equipment, but, knowing that, I did not take that the scope showed nothing as proof of no pulse. I reasoned my way to the fact that a pulse had to exist at that point which was too narrow for the scope to show. Taking care of the pulse that the scope did not show made the unit work. Thus, if you know what you have anything is better than nothing. If, however, you do not know the limitations of your stuff, nothing is better than anything. Erik |
